If the name -- does not match any aspect, then No_Aspect is returned as the result. + --------------------------------------------------- + -- Handling of Aspect Specifications in the Tree -- + --------------------------------------------------- + + -- Several kinds of declaration node permit aspect specifications in Ada + -- 2012 mode. If there was room in all the corresponding declaration nodes, + -- we could just have a field Aspect_Specifications pointing to a list of + -- nodes for the aspects (N_Aspect_Specification nodes). But there isn't + -- room, so we adopt a different approach. + + -- The following subprograms provide access to a specialized interface + -- implemented internally with a hash table in the body, that provides + -- access to aspect specifications. + + function Permits_Aspect_Specifications (N : Node_Id) return Boolean; + -- Returns True if the node N is a declaration node that permits aspect + -- specifications. All such nodes have the Has_Aspect_Specifications + -- flag defined. Returns False for all other nodes. + + function Aspect_Specifications (N : Node_Id) return List_Id; + -- Given a node N, returns the list of N_Aspect_Specification nodes that + -- are attached to this declaration node. If the node is in the class of + -- declaration nodes that permit aspect specifications, as defined by the + -- predicate above, and if their Has_Aspect_Specifications flag is set to + -- True, then this will always be a non-empty list. If this flag is set to + -- False, or the node is not in the declaration class permitting aspect + -- specifications, then No_List is returned. + + procedure Set_Aspect_Specifications (N : Node_Id; L : List_Id); + -- The node N must be in the class of declaration nodes that permit aspect + -- specifications and the Has_Aspect_Specifications flag must be False on + -- entry. L must be a non-empty list of N_Aspect_Specification nodes. This + -- procedure sets the Has_Aspect_Specifications flag to True, and makes an + -- entry that can be retrieved by a subsequent Aspect_Specifications call. + -- The parent of list L is set to reference the declaration node N. It is + -- an error to call this procedure with a node that does not permit aspect + -- specifications, or a node that has its Has_Aspect_Specifications flag + -- set True on entry, or with L being an empty list or No_List. + end Aspects; |
